When an individual goes to his doctor with a complaint, the doctor will get information from the patient, in an attempt to build a complete history of the origins and probable causes of the complaint. The information obtained from the patient will include patients past and present medical history, lab results, previous medical conditions and prescribed medications, radiology images etc., all do the patients’ medical records. When this information is put into a digital format it is known as the individual electronic medical records.

Just like any new approach to doing things, EHR (Electronic Health Records) has its advantages and disadvantages. The electronic medical records kept benefits include: -
Better documentation
Doctors are legendary for handwritten illegible that lead to the entry of inaccurate data from a second or third. With the help of electronic health records, this problem above all becomes a thing of the past.
Lower cost
It is hoped that the use of EHR will reduce long-term health care costs and promote evidence-based care. As information is readily available and easily and quickly laid before proceeding with the best treatment option, resources are saved as the period of the patient's disease is reduced.
Better storage
Large amounts of information can be stored in a digital format by taking a tiny amount of storage space by eliminating problems that currently exist with paper and pen system.
Easy retrieval of information
Health records online
With the information in digital format, it is easy and quick to retrieve information saving time and labor. With the patient's medical records just a click of the mouse, individuals previously involved in the file location and recovery will be reassigned to other positions.
Reduced malpractice insurance premiums
With readable and accurate documentation of electronic health record system providers, insurance companies tend to reduce malpractice awards for institutions that use EHR system. Even in a case of litigation about the trail it is easy to follow and will make a difference in the outcome of a case if things were ambiguous.
Increased health care level
With patients full medical record just a few clicks away, a doctor has instant access to medical information of the patient enabling a faster and better response to provide medical assistance.
Accurate keeping of registers
Electronic health records make it easy to keep accurate records of who has access to patient information when it has been accessed and by whom. And when changes are made to a patient's record, you can find out who and when altered.
